| Description of the problem | Driver & passenger sun visors have either fallen off completely and/or no longer able to stay up and out of way. This has occurred several times throughout the years. We've replaced these visors 2 to 3 times, at least once with dealer. Never notified of any recall throughout the years. Most recent incident occurred the morning of 7/18/17, when driver side visor suddenly became loose from its upward position and released to an unstable downward position. This sudden obstruction nearly resulted in an accident as the visor blocked the driver's view while the vehicle was in motion. Driver was able to avoid a collision, but was required to hold the visor out of the way before being able to pull over and try to maneuver visor upwards to lock in place to no success. Driver at that point had to remove visor for safety reasons. Passenger visor already fell off earlier on its own and now the driver's side has been removed; vehicle no longer has sun visors. Vehicle operator lives in central arizona with consistently "very high" uv index. The loss of visors makes this car difficult to drive during daytime, even with independent eye protection (ie: sunglasses) as well as with he visors' unreliability to remain attached to the car's interior. |
